How to bathe a Samoyed dog

1. You can comb the Samoyed dog's hair before washing. This can not only prevent the hair from being messed up, but also relax the dog. If it is still not good, tie it up.
2. You can choose to shower your Samoyed dog, or you can use it in a bathtub, or you can use both at the same time. If you use a bathtub, the bathtub should be larger than the dog. It would be best if there is a [non-slip mat]. The water level is above the knees (the Samoyed's knees), and the water temperature is mild.
3. First pour the water on the Samoyed to let the Samoyed relax. Don’t splash it directly. Don’t forget to plug the ears with cotton strips!
4. When the Samoyed dog has just relaxed, take out the pet shower gel and apply it to the Samoyed dog. Massage it as much as possible and rub it gently when it reaches the head
5. After applying the application, you can try to express the anal glands first (it is very important, but also very difficult and very vomiting). Let’s do some popular science:
Anal gland is a gland in dogs, also known as anal sac. It is a pair of pear-shaped glands, located at about four o'clock and eight o'clock on both sides of the dog's anus, one on each side and one on each side. Open your mouth. The anal gland sacs are filled with anal gland fluid, which will turn into black or dark brown liquid or mud if it accumulates for a long time. The smell is terrible.
Sometimes we see puppies grinding their buttocks on the ground, it may be that the dog’s anal gland outlet is blocked and inflamed. When the obstruction is mild, the dog will grind its buttocks on the ground or lick its buttocks; in severe cases, the anal glands will be swollen and painful, making it difficult for the dog to defecate and even cause greater pain.
6. Rinse clean after squeezing. Then rinse it with water from head to tail. Don't wash it where you grab it. Rinse thoroughly to prevent skin diseases
7. Blow dry with a hair dryer. Be sure to blow dry. Don’t just dry the surface, as it is easy to catch a cold. Don't just blow in one place, it will hurt and the hair will be scorched. The best distance between the hair dryer and the dog is 25 to 30 centimeters.
